CATARMAN, Northern Samar- Senator Cynthia Villar said that protecting the already fragile environment of the country and the rest of the world is very important.
And she is thankful that there are still groups like the Philippine Environmental Science Association (PESA) which gives importance in preserving the environment through their various research works, Villar, who is the chairperson of the committee on environment at the Senate said Thursday (June 13).
“The goal for which the PESA was organized is to strengthen the value of environmental science as an inter-disciplinary field in analyzing and providing solutions to the perennial environmental problems of the country,” Villar said in her speech at the 7th Annual International Conference on Environmental Science held at the University of Eastern Philippines, this town.
Villar added that it is good to note that the youth particularly the students of the member-universities of PESA are not only concerned about the problems of the environment but are committed in finding solutions.
The senator believed that science through research and technology plays a very important role in solving various problems in various fields and sectors.
She further added that she supports PESA’s pro- active stance to continuously upgrade and advance the level of environmental science research an actions to address the environmental problems affecting the country.
She also appreciated that the conference tackled key environmental topics and issues such as climate change, bio diversity and conservation, disaster risk management and sustainable solutions.
Villar pointed out that the inputs, ideas and innovations that will result from the three-day conference will affect or solve not only environmental problems will also benefit many other sectors.
Villar stressed that protecting the environment is not just a concern of certain sector but by every individual.
